This Massive 5-Story Ohio Bookstore Feels Like An All-Day Adventure

Grace Peak 5 min read

If you love the kind of places where time seems to slow down, Ohio Book Store in downtown Cincinnati is the sort of spot that can take over your whole day. Tucked inside a historic building on Main Street, this beloved used bookstore rises floor after floor with shelves that seem to stretch forever.

Every level offers a different mood, from quiet literary wandering to the thrill of spotting a rare old treasure. By the time you leave, you may feel like you visited a bookstore, a museum, and a secret local landmark all at once.

3. What you can find on the shelves

What you can find on the shelves
© Ohio Book Store

One reason people rave about Ohio Book Store is the range of material packed into its shelves. You can come in looking for classics, history, cookbooks, art books, presidential biographies, science fiction, or local Ohio titles, then leave with something you never expected to buy.

Visitors also mention magazines, comic books, old encyclopedias, historical maps, vintage postcards, and collectible editions that make the store feel broader than a typical used bookstore.

The selection seems especially rewarding for readers who like older and more unusual material. Several reviews highlight first editions, obscure volumes, and well-preserved texts that are hard to stumble upon elsewhere.

That means the thrill here is not just quantity, but the chance to spot an 1883 Shakespeare adaptation, a niche transportation title, or a beautiful forgotten cookbook.

This is the kind of inventory that rewards curiosity. The more patient you are, the better your odds get.

5. Why it feels bigger than a bookstore

Why it feels bigger than a bookstore

Ohio Book Store stands out because it offers more than shelves and sales. It also carries the feeling of a living literary institution, one that preserves books, stories, and physical craftsmanship in a way many stores no longer do.

Several visitors mention the in-house bookbinding and restoration work, and one customer specifically praised the rebinding of a worn Bible, calling the results remarkable and worth the cost.

That detail changes how you see the entire place. This is not just somewhere to buy another used paperback and move on.

It is a bookstore tied to preservation, care, and continuity, which helps explain why so many people describe it as a treasure, a cultural icon, or the coolest bookstore they have visited.
